I use a KeePassXC database on a syncthing share and haven’t had any issues. You get synchronization and offline access, and even if there are sync conflicts, the app can merge the two files.
One benefit to hosted password vaults over files is that they can use 2FA - you can’t exactly do TOTP with a static file.
(As an aside, I wish more “self hosted” apps were instead “local file and sync friendly” apps instead, exactly because of offline access)
You can do 2FA with Keepass, just not TOTP. Add a key file or a hardware key on top of your master password and you pass “something that you have and something that you know” test
KeepassXC handles TOTP.
It can generate TOTP codes, but I’m saying that the vault itself can’t be secured with TOTP.
Then the difference is really that someone else is handing the security, right? At the end of the day, there’s an encrypted file somewhere, and a TOTP only protects a particular connection by network.
Sure, but there’s a big difference between a vault copied and synced on all of my mobile devices that I could easily lose versus only on a server behind locked doors.

If you self host bitwarden/vaultwarden, each client stores an encrypted copy of the database, so even if your server was completely destroyed, you’d still have access to all the accounts you’re saving in it.

I self-Host Vaultwarden at home, this way I have a convenient password manager for myself and my SO, it’s easy to setup and maintain. East to access from the phone, Firefox, etc. Bitwarden app keeps a local cache so even when disconnected from the server I have access to my passwords and it will synchronize at the next connections. I otherwise have a Wireguard VPN setup in case I need to connect to my home server from outside my home.
Before I used KeePass+syncthing but it was to much configuration to convince my SO to use it. Bitwarden/Vaultwarden was more successful in that regard.

I’ve used cloud based services for password managers for work and “self host” my personal stuff. I barely consider it self hosting since I use Keepass and on every machine it’s configured to keep a local cached copy of the database but primarily to pull from the database file on my in-home NAS.
Two issues I’ve had:
Logging into an account on a device currently not on my home network is brutal. I often resort to simply viewing the needed password and painstakingly type it in (and I run with loooooong passwords)
If I add or change a password on a desktop and don’t sync my phone before I leave, I get locked out of accounts. Two years rocking this setup it’s happened three times, twice I just said meh I don’t really need to do this now, a third time I went through account recovery and set a new password from my phone.
Minor complaint:
Sometimes Keepass2Android gets stuck trying to open the remote database and I have to let it sit and timeout (5 minutes!!!) which gets really annoying but happens very infrequently which is why I say just minor complaint
All in all, I find the inconvenience of doing the personal setup so low that to me even a $10 annual subscription is not worth it
